Simply so, how do you reduce swelling after inguinal hernia surgery?
Swelling over the incision is common after hernia surgery. It doesn't mean that the surgery was unsuccessful. To reduce swelling and pain, put ice or a cold pack on the area for 10 to 20 minutes at a time. Do this every 1 to 2 hours.
Also, what should I expect after my hernia surgery? Most people are able to return to work within 1 to 2 weeks after surgery. But if your job requires that you to do heavy lifting or strenuous activity, you may need to take 4 to 6 weeks off from work. You may shower 24 to 48 hours after surgery, if your doctor okays it. Pat the cut (incision) dry.
Hereof, is bloating normal after hernia surgery?
Surgical Site Swelling at surgical sites is normal; this will often feel like a firm ridge. Abdominal bloating is common. It is common for swelling of genital areas and fluid accumulation in the groin after hernia surgery; sometimes this can feel firm like a lump.

Related Question AnswersDo your balls swell after hernia surgery?
Men who have had an inguinal hernia repair may find their scrotum is swollen and turn black and blue. This is normal and may worsen after a few days. To help reduce swelling, use ice packs and wear supportive underwear such as briefs. The scrotum will return to normal in a few weeks.What happens if you lift too much after hernia surgery?

What should I wear after inguinal hernia surgery?
Men will need to wear a jockstrap or briefs, not boxers, for scrotal support for several days after a groin (inguinal) hernia repair. Spandex bicycle shorts may provide good support. After surgery, most patients will be asked to avoid lifting anything heavier than 15 pounds for the first two weeks, though more complicated patients may have differing limitations. Pain persisting beyond the first few days after groin hernia repair is recognized to affect small numbers of patients, generally estimated to be 10–15% of hernias repaired. In nearly all of these patients, the pain subsides postoperatively over the early months.How do you sleep after an inguinal hernia surgery?

It is possible that the repair is still intact and bulging of the mesh causes swelling. Bulging can be the result of an insufficient surgical technique. The problem is more frequently seen after repair of large defects, especially when mesh are used to bridge the defects, and more frequent after laparoscopic repair,,.How long will my stomach be swollen after hernia surgery?
Since normal swelling after hernia surgery is part of the healing process, the body can take three to six months to get rid of the swelling. In patients with very large inguinal hernia that extend down to the scrotum, sometimes the swelling may be there for longer than six months.What should I avoid after hernia surgery?

How do I get rid of gas after hernia surgery?
DO- Drink warm liquids.
- Walk outside your room three to four times daily.
- After meals: walk, and then sit up in a chair for 30 to 60 minutes.
- Sit upright in a chair three to four times daily.
- Lie on your left side rather than on your back to help move gas through your bowels.
- Eat slowly.
- Eat small amounts.
- Chew your food well.
